                                             The second classification is elaboration, which explains why an

                                   answer  is  correct  or  incorrect  and  allows  more  time  to  relearn.  It


                                   incorporates attribution isolation, response contingent, hints, bugs, and


                                   informative tutoring.  Attributing isolation is concerned with providing

                                   key characteristics of what is being learned. The response contingent

                                   then explains the individual's correct or incorrect answers. While hints


                                   provide indications or cues to guide the individual toward the proper

                                   answer,  bugs  clarify  the  individual's  misconceptions  through  error


                                   analysis and diagnosis. The final type of tutoring is informed tutoring,

                                   in  which  the  individual  is  given  feedback  with  error  flagging  and


                                   strategic advice on proceeding without providing the correct answer.
